Technical Data
Model | 10A | 15A | 20A | 30A |
Rated Charge Current | 10A | 15A | 20A | 30A |
Rated Load Current | 10A | 15A | 20A | 30A |
System Voltage | 12V/24V AUTO | |||
Over load, short circuit protection | 1.25 times by rated current, 60 seconds, 1.5 times by rated current,5 seconds--- overload protection; ≥3 times by rated current--- short circuit protection | |||
No-load loss | ≤6mA | |||
Charge Circuit Voltage Drop | ≤0.26V | |||
Discharge Circuit Voltage Drop | ≤0.15V | |||
Over Voltage Protection | 17V, ×2/24V | |||
Working Temperature | Industrial Grade: -35℃-+55℃ (Suffix I ) | |||
Increase Charge Voltage | 14.6V, ×2/24V (10mins when discharging) | |||
Direct Charge Voltage | 14.4V, ×2/24V (10 mins ) | |||
Float Charge Voltage | 13.6V, ×2/24V (till come down to charging recovery voltage) | |||
Charge Recovery Voltage | 13.2V, ×2/24V | |||
Temperature Compensation | -5mv/℃/2v | |||
Under Voltage | 12.0V, ×2/24V | |||
Over discharge Voltage | 11.1V, ×2/24V | |||
Over Discharge Recovery Voltage | 12.6V, ×2/24V | |||
Control Mode | PWM | |||
Dimension | 133×70×33.5(mm) | |||
Weight | 140~160(g) |
